Mohamed Karray
Associate Professor
Mohamed KARRAY received the M.Sc. degree in Electrical Engineering from the National School of Engineers of Sfax (ENIS), in 2000 and the Ph.D. degree in Electronics from Télécom Paris, in 2004. He is currently an Associate Professor at ESME, a position he has held since 2012. Prior to this, he served as an Assistant Professor at several academic institutions. His research interests include embedded systems, embedded artificial intelligence (AI), smart transportation, and brain-computer interfaces (BCI).
